    I've heard of some grainy screens being present on M1730's, but these can be quickly replaced if you have Dell's Complete Care warranty. I had multiple bad pixels + bleeding backlight issues on my previous screen, but Dell came through and replaced it with a defect-free Samsung screen.

    EDIT: as for performance, the M1730 with twin 8800M-GTX SLI really screams, but you have to use something other than Dell's newest factory video drivers to get best performance.
